HUNTINGTON - Chris Rippon, bespectacled and slight of build, probably wouldn't win an audition to play the role of a college football coach on stage or screen.

But after a quarter of a century in the business, the defensive and special teams whiz called Coach Rip is actually a "quintessential longtime assistant," according to ESPN senior writer Bruce Feldman.
